    Abstract: The present invention relates to a motor vehicle lock having a lock catch and a locking pawl. The lock catch may be brought into an opening position, a main locking position and a preliminary locking position. The locking pawl can be brought into a lowered and raised position. The locking pawl may be arranged to hold and release the lock catch in a direction of its opening position. A memory element is assigned to the locking pawl and arranged to keep the locking pawl in the raised position. The memory element may operate with a control apparatus. The locking pawl may be releasable by motor from the raised position and may further be moveable in a direction of its lowered position unhindered by the memory element. The release by motor of the locking pawl is controllable at a predetermined triggering time by the control apparatus.

    Abstract: An actuator for a motor vehicle has a drive motor, an actuating element and a blocking element. The blocking element can be deflected by the actuating element, against pretensioning, into a blocking position in which the blocking element blocks further movement of the actuating element. For this deflection, the blocking element is equipped with a tappet and the actuating element is equipped with a power transmission element. The actuating element is equipped with a stop and the blocking element is equipped with an counter-stop for blocking. Before the blocking is produced, the power transmission element releases the tappet, and after release, the blocking element, driven by its pretensioning, causes its counter-stop to fall onto the stop of the actuating element in a catch position.

    Abstract: A holding device for a motor vehicle safety with a component which can be displaced out of a rest position suddenly into an action position, with a holding element. Such a motor vehicle safety means is, for example, a head support/roll bar which extends automatically in an accident. The holding device has a latch which fixes the component in the rest position and a ratchet arrangement which holds the latch in the engagement position. The ratchet arrangement has ratchet kinematics and an adjustable blocking element. By moving the latch out of the engagement position into the direction of the release position, the ratchet kinematics are moved and the blocking element blocks the movement of the ratchet kinematics which can be caused by the latch.

    Abstract: A motor vehicle lock with an electrically openable motor vehicle lock and a child safety is proposed. A very simple and economical structure is enabled in that the opening mechanism, which can be manually actuated from the inside, can be blocked exclusively by manual actuation and the child safety can be overridden and re-enabled electrically without mechanical mechanisms. Here, a version is especially interesting in which the electrically operating child safety is temporarily deactivated (overridden) so that then, during the time interval of deactivation, the motor vehicle can be electrically opened in spite of a manually activated child safety.

    Abstract: A motor vehicle lock with a latch and an associated ratchet and a motor for opening the ratchet. The motor vehicle lock has a flexible traction means which directly or indirectly connects the motor to the ratchet and which is wound up by the motor for opening the ratchet and which can be unwound by spring force when the motor is turned off.

    Abstract: The invention relates to a motor vehicle lock with a latch and a ratchet arrangement. The latch is able to swivel around a swivelling axis, and be moved into an open position, a main locked position and optionally a preliminary locked position. The ratchet arrangement is able to be moved into at least one holding position and into a release position. The ratchet arrangement when in the holding position, keeps the latch, in any case, in the main locked position. The ratchet arrangement includes ratchet kinematics and an adjustable blocking element. By resetting the latch out of the main locked position in the direction of the open position the ratchet kinematics is moved and when the ratchet arrangement is in the holding position the blocking element blocks the movement of the ratchet kinematics which can be caused by the latch and thus blocks the resetting of the latch.

    Abstract: An electric motor actuator for a motor vehicle lock, with a reversible drive motor, an actuator drive which can be rotary driven by the drive motor. The actuator further includes an operating lever which is dynamically coupled to the actuator drive for switching the lock into an “unlocked” and “locked” operating state, an antitheft lever which is spring-loaded with a pretensioning spring and which is dynamically coupled to the actuator drive for holding the operating lever in the “locked” operating state. An emergency actuating element is used for manually engaging an antitheft lever into an “antitheft off” operating state to overcome a catch element on the actuator drive.
